在处理PDF文件时,数字证书签名是一个常见的需求,它用于验证文档的完整性和真实性。然而,有时候我们可能会遇到PDF数字证书签名失败的问题。别担心,以下是一些实用的技巧,帮助你轻松解决这个问题。
1. 确认数字证书的有效性
首先,确保你的数字证书是有效的。这包括检查证书是否过期、是否被吊销以及是否与你的用户名匹配。
检查证书有效期
- 方法一:打开数字证书,查看“有效期”部分。
- 方法二:使用命令行工具,如
certutil -store My -find <证书名称>,检查证书的起始和结束日期。
检查证书吊销
- 方法一:使用在线证书吊销列表(CRL)或在线证书状态协议(OCSP)检查证书是否被吊销。
- 方法二:在证书属性中查看“吊销状态”。
检查证书与用户名匹配
确保数字证书的用户名与你的用户名相匹配。
2. 检查PDF软件的兼容性
不同的PDF软件对数字证书的支持程度不同。确保你使用的PDF软件支持你的数字证书。
更新PDF软件
- 定期更新你的PDF软件,以确保它支持最新的数字证书格式。
尝试其他PDF软件
如果当前软件不支持,尝试使用其他流行的PDF软件,如Adobe Acrobat、Foxit Reader等。
3. 清除PDF文件中的旧签名
有时候,PDF文件中可能存在旧的签名,这可能导致新的签名失败。
删除旧签名
- 打开PDF文件,找到旧的签名。
- 使用PDF软件的编辑功能删除旧的签名。
4. 使用正确的签名工具
确保你使用的是正确的签名工具。有些PDF软件提供了内置的签名功能,而有些则需要使用第三方签名工具。
内置签名功能
- 检查你的PDF软件是否提供内置的签名功能。
- 如果提供,按照软件的指示进行签名。
第三方签名工具
- 如果内置签名功能不可用,尝试使用第三方签名工具,如SignNow、HelloSign等。
5. 保持耐心和细心
在处理数字证书签名时,耐心和细心至关重要。
小贴士
- 仔细阅读PDF软件和数字证书的文档。
- 如果遇到问题,不要慌张,逐步解决问题。
通过以上这些实用的技巧,相信你能够轻松解决PDF数字证书签名失败的问题。记住,保持耐心和细心,你一定能够成功!
